Latency measurements break for loads less than 9 kpps per direction.
Setting min_rate to 90 kpps prevents 10% latency trial from breaking.
90 kpps should be enough for any type of test.
When some test finds a lower value, this patch will make the fail
with a message saying the loss rate at minimal load is too high
(instead of a cryptic error from 10% measurement without this patch).
